原文:鏈表的增加和刪除

鏈表節點的插入與刪除 編譯環境:VC . 編譯系統:windows XP SP include lt stdio.h gt include lt stdlib.h gt include lt malloc.h gt 定義鏈表中的節點 typedef struct node int member 節點中的成員 struct node pNext 指向下一個節點的指針 Node, pNode 函數聲 ...

2019-04-16 20:32 0 1082 推薦指數:

查看詳情

Java實現鏈表增加刪除,打印

Java中我們使用的ArrayList,其實現原理是數組。而LinkedList的實現原理就是鏈表了。鏈表在進行循環遍歷時效率不高,但是插入和刪除時優勢明顯。 說明:以下代碼是按照自己理解實現,有不正確的地方,請批評指正!! 1. 定義結點類 2. 建表(尾插法) 3. ...

Tue Oct 08 00:21:00 CST 2019 0 803
刪除鏈表,你會嗎?

刪除鏈表中值等於XXX的所有元素 不經意間看到了一個不同尋常的實現方法,覺得挺有意思,於是自己實現了一下,代碼真的是簡單明了跑得還賊快! 好,現在先在腦海中想想,你會怎么實現?這么簡單,5秒鍾后,你想到了解決方案,於是你決定驗證你的思路,請繼續往下 ...

Thu Dec 19 21:25:00 CST 2019 0 823
刪除鏈表中的節點--鏈表

題目 請編寫一個函數,使其可以刪除某個鏈表中給定的(非末尾)節點,你將只被給定要求被刪除的節點。 現有一個鏈表 -- head = [4,5,1,9],它可以表示為: 示例 1: 示例 2: 說明: 鏈表至少包含兩個節點。 鏈表 ...

Wed Dec 04 19:03:00 CST 2019 0 656
鏈表操作之刪除

)需要的時間和內存都是常數的,除非必須調整數組的大小。對於單鏈表來說,從末尾刪除的操作假設結構中至少有一個 ...

Sat Sep 05 05:52:00 CST 2020 0 1306
鏈表的插入和刪除

近期,數據結構課上布置了運用單鏈表進行簡單的插入和刪除工作,今天,就在這里跟大家講一下單鏈表的插入和刪除是怎么弄的 1.結點的定義 View Code 這里的data就是我們鏈表里的數據元素了,next就是結點了也就是我們經常看到的p->next ...

Tue Oct 08 01:48:00 CST 2019 0 638
鏈表-刪除第i個結點

刪除第 i 個結點 假設 i=3 ,刪除后效果如下: 刪除第 i 個元素,要找到第 i-1 個元素,要修改其指針域。 算法步驟: ① 找到第 i-1 個元素的存儲位置 p,保存要刪除的 ai 的值 ② 令p->next 指向ai+1,如圖:p->next ...

Fri Apr 23 05:27:00 CST 2021 0 336
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M